The number of moles of O2 that are needed to react with 24 moles of C2H6 is 84 moles of O2 Explanation Step 1: write the equation for reaction = 2C2H6 + 7O2 → 4CO2 + 6H2O Step 2: use the mole ratio to determine the moles of O2 that is the mole ratio of C2H6 : O2 is 2:7 therefore the moles of O2 = 24 x7/2 = 84 moles of O2 (ii) Number of moles of hydrogen atoms. now find total moles of gas in the container using the ideal gas law, PV=nRT.
